What is Mangal Dosha?
Mangal Dosha occurs when Mars (Mangal) is placed in the 1st, 2nd, 4th, 7th, 8th or 12th house of a birth chart. Mars is a fiery, assertive planet, and its placement in these houses can create tension in marital relationships if not balanced.
How Common is it?
Contrary to popular belief, Mangal Dosha is quite common, affecting approximately 40 to 50 percent of horoscopes. The intensity matters far more than mere presence.
When Does Mangal Dosha Cancel?
In many cases Mangal Dosha is cancelled by specific planetary placements. Key cancellations include both partners having Mangal Dosha, Mars in its own sign (Aries or Scorpio), and specific conjunctions with Jupiter or Moon.
